About the Jr. Sous Chef role

Aspiring culinary professionals looking to advance their careers will find that Jr. Sous Chef jobs represent a critical stepping stone between line cook and executive leadership. This mid-level management role is the backbone of a professional kitchen, serving as the direct liaison between the executive or head chef and the culinary team. Individuals in these roles are responsible for overseeing the daily operations of one or more kitchen stations, ensuring that every dish leaving the pass meets the establishment’s exacting standards for taste, temperature, and presentation.

The primary responsibilities of a Junior Sous Chef are a blend of hands-on cooking, team supervision, and administrative support. On any given day, a professional in this role might be found expediting orders during a dinner rush, training new cooks on proper knife skills, or managing inventory to minimize waste. They are tasked with preparing and cooking food items according to standardized recipes, regulating cooking equipment temperatures, and ensuring proper portion control. Beyond the stoves, these chefs play a vital role in maintaining food safety and sanitation logs, rotating stock to ensure freshness, and communicating menu specials or shortages to the front-of-house staff. They also assist in the hiring, scheduling, and coaching of kitchen employees, serving as a role model for punctuality, professionalism, and teamwork.

To succeed in Jr. Sous Chef jobs, candidates typically need a blend of formal education and substantial experience. Most employers require a high school diploma or equivalent, with a preference for a degree or certificate from a recognized culinary school. This educational background is usually paired with two to four years of progressive experience in a high-volume culinary environment. Technical skills are paramount; a successful candidate must be proficient in all cooking methods—from grilling and sautéing to braising and pastry work—and must understand how to use and maintain commercial kitchen equipment like broilers, fryers, and ovens.

Equally important are the soft skills required for leadership. A Junior Sous Chef must possess excellent communication abilities to clearly delegate tasks and resolve conflicts under pressure. They need strong organizational skills to manage multiple orders simultaneously and the physical stamina to stand for extended periods while lifting heavy pots and supplies. A keen attention to detail is non-negotiable, as is a calm demeanor when facing the inevitable chaos of a busy service. Ultimately, these jobs are ideal for those who are passionate about food, eager to mentor others, and ready to take on the responsibility of ensuring a kitchen runs smoothly, efficiently, and profitably. This role offers a direct path to mastering the art of culinary management and is a vital position in any reputable dining establishment.
